Job Description

The Associate Director of Power Delivery at Atwell is responsible for leading and supporting power infrastructure projects, providing technical guidance, managing teams, fostering client relationships, and contributing to business growth within the electrical power delivery sector.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ead and support power delivery projects including transmission, distribution, substations, protection and controls, and interconnection.
  • Provide technical guidance and oversight for engineering, design, project execution, and quality control activities.
  • Manage, mentor, and support project managers, engineers, designers, and technical staff.
  • Serve as a primary client contact to ensure effective communication and successful project delivery.
  • Assist in managing project scope, budget, schedule, staffing, and resources.
  • Support business development efforts by maintaining client relationships and pursuing new opportunities.
  • Contribute to team growth through recruiting, onboarding, mentorship, and technical development.
  • Help improve internal processes, standards, workflows, and delivery practices.
  • Participate in annual planning, including forecasting, staffing, and market growth initiatives.
  • Ensure consistency, quality, and technical excellence across project deliverables.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Civil Engineering, or a related field
  • PE license preferred
  • 8 years of experience in Power Delivery, electric utility, consulting, or related power infrastructure work
  • Experience in one or more of the following areas: transmission, distribution, substations, protection and controls, power system studies, interconnection, or utility infrastructure
  • Proven experience managing projects, leading teams, and supporting client relationships
  • Ability to provide technical oversight while also supporting project management, staffing, and operational needs
  • Demonstrated ability to mentor junior staff and develop engineering or design talent
  • Strong understanding of engineering and design workflows for power delivery projects
  • Experience working with utility clients, renewable energy clients, developers, or large-scale infrastructure clients (preferred)
